Influence of Sunlight Intensity



In some cases, the intensity of sunlight can dramatically affect the performance of photovoltaic panels. When the sunlight is strong and direct, your solar panels create more electrical power. Nevertheless, throughout over cast days or when the sun is at a reduced angle, the panels obtain less sunlight, reducing their efficiency. To make the most of the energy outcome of your photovoltaic panels, it's essential to install them in areas with enough sunlight direct exposure throughout the day. Take into consideration factors like shading from neighboring trees or buildings that could obstruct sunshine and lower the panels' efficiency.

To enhance the effectiveness of your photovoltaic panels, frequently tidy them to eliminate any dirt, dust, or debris that may be blocking sunshine absorption. Additionally, ensure that your panels are angled appropriately to receive one of the most direct sunshine feasible.

Impact of Temperature Adjustments



When temperature adjustments take place, they can have a substantial effect on the efficiency of solar panels. Solar panels function finest in cooler temperature levels, making them a lot more effective on moderate days compared to exceptionally hot ones. As the temperature level increases, solar panels can experience a decrease in performance because of a phenomenon referred to as the temperature level coefficient. This result triggers a reduction in voltage output, eventually influencing the overall power manufacturing of the panels.

Alternatively, when temperatures drop as well reduced, photovoltaic panels can likewise be impacted. Exceptionally cold temperatures can result in a reduction in conductivity within the panels, making them less effective in creating electricity. This is why it's critical to consider the temperature level conditions when mounting photovoltaic panels to maximize their efficiency.

Role of Cloud Cover and Rain



Cloud cover and rains can dramatically impact the performance of solar panels. When clouds obstruct the sun, the quantity of sunlight reaching your photovoltaic panels is lowered, resulting in a decline in power manufacturing. Rain can additionally impact solar panel performance by obstructing sunlight and creating a layer of dirt or crud on the panels, additionally lowering their ability to produce electricity. Even light rain can scatter sunlight, triggering it to be less concentrated on the panels.



Throughout overcast days with hefty cloud cover, photovoltaic panels may experience a substantial drop in energy outcome. However, cost solar panel installation keeping in mind that some modern photovoltaic panel technologies can still produce electrical energy also when the sky is over cast. Additionally, rain can have a cleaning effect on photovoltaic panels, getting rid of dust and dust that might have collected over time.

To maximize the performance of your solar panels, it's essential to consider the impact of cloud cover and rainfall on power production and make certain that your panels are correctly kept to hold up against differing climate condition.
